we have recently been talking quite a bit--because, frankly, unless we talk about it people won't know what happened--about how productive we have been over the last year and a half in advancing legislation that benefits the American people, which is, of course, the reason why they sent us here. I say we have been talking about it, because if we don't talk about it, maybe they will never learn, and even if we talked about it, some of them may never believe it. But the fact of the matter is that we need to talk about what we are doing here for the people we represent. Of course, nothing happens in the Senate or in Congress or in Washington unless it is done on a bipartisan basis. But leadership matters. Leadership matters. We have seen with the new Republican majority in the 114th Congress, under Senator McConnell and Speaker Ryan now, that we have been able to pass some important legislation. This includes legislation to combat the epidemic of opioid abuse throughout our Nation. We passed an important piece of legislation called the Comprehensive Addiction and Recovery Act to deal with it. But I want to talk about another aspect of the prescription drug problem or issue and reflect on some bipartisan legislation we passed 6 years ago--obviously, with people on both sides of the aisle and in both Chambers--when we came together to tackle another issue related to prescription drugs.
